"man freebsd-version" doesn't help in this issue. The reason why my freebsd-update always tries "Fetching metadata signature for *10.2-STABLE* from update.FreeBSD.org" is because I used the wrong kernel source (the stable branch) to build my custom kernel, hence uname -r shows 10.2-STABLE. I guess freebsd-update uses uname to determine system version. I recompiled the kernel using https://svn.freebsd.org/base/releng/10.2 and now freebsd-update works fine.
